    The Borough of Slough is a unitary authority with borough status in the ceremonial county of Berkshire, Southern England. The borough is centred around the town of Slough and includes Langley . It forms an urban area with parts of Buckinghamshire and extends to the villages of Burnham , Farnham Royal , George Green , and Iver .

    In 2017, unemployment stood at 1.4%, [6] one-third the UK average of 4.5%. [7] Slough has the highest concentration of UK HQs of global companies outside London. Slough Trading Estate is the largest industrial estate in single private ownership in Europe, with over 17,000 jobs in 400 businesses. [8]

    The 2023 Slough Borough Council election took place on 4 May 2023 to elect members of Slough Borough Council in Berkshire, England. [1] This was on the same day as other local elections in England . Following a boundary review all 42 seats on the council were up for election and there was also a change to the electoral cycle for Slough.

    Slough was, from 1863 to 1974, a local government district in southern Buckinghamshire, England. [3] It became an urban district in 1894 and was incorporated as a municipal borough in 1938. It was abolished in 1974 and now forms part of the borough of Slough in Berkshire .
